UP Diwas 2026: Uttar Pradesh Celebrates 76th Foundation Day, Leaders Highlight State’s Growth and Cultural Legacy

Marking January 24, 1950, as its formation day, Uttar Pradesh celebrates UP Diwas with messages from the President, PM Modi, and other leaders, calling the state India’s cultural heart and a key growth engine.
Indian Masterminds Stories

Lucknow: Uttar Pradesh is celebrating its 76th Foundation Day (UP Diwas) today, January 24, 2026. The state was officially formed on January 24, 1950, when the name United Provinces was changed to Uttar Pradesh. Every year, this day is marked to honor the state’s rich history, culture, and contribution to India’s development.

Why January 24 Is Important for Uttar Pradesh

January 24 holds special importance for Uttar Pradesh as it marks the day when the state got its present name and identity. Until the year 2000, present-day Uttarakhand was also part of Uttar Pradesh. In 2000, the hilly regions of Kumaon and Garhwal were separated and given statehood as Uttaranchal, which was later renamed Uttarakhand.

A Land of Culture, Spirituality, and History

Uttar Pradesh is considered the heart of India’s cultural and spiritual heritage.

  • Ayodhya is associated with Lord Ram
  • Mathura and Vrindavan with Lord Krishna
  • Sarnath with Lord Buddha
  • Prayagraj with the sacred confluence of the Ganga and Yamuna
  • Agra is home to the Taj Mahal
  • Varanasi is one of the world’s oldest living cities

This unique blend of history, spirituality, politics, and culture makes Uttar Pradesh one of India’s most important states.

Brief History of Uttar Pradesh

  • 1807: Known as Ceded and Conquered Provinces
  • 1834: Renamed Agra Presidency
  • 1836: Became North-Western Provinces
  • 1902: Merged as United Provinces of Agra and Oudh
  • 1946: Shortened to United Provinces
  • 1950: Renamed Uttar Pradesh
  • 2000: Formation of Uttarakhand from its hill regions

Uttar Pradesh Diwas was officially celebrated for the first time in 2018.

President Droupadi Murmu’s Message

President Droupadi Murmu congratulated the people of Uttar Pradesh on UP Diwas. In her message, she said that Uttar Pradesh, with its glorious history and rich culture, has been a strong pillar of India’s development journey. She expressed confidence that the state will continue to move forward on the path of progress and wished a bright future for its hardworking and talented people.

PM Narendra Modi: From BIMARU to a Remarkable State

Prime Minister Narendra Modi extended his greetings to the people of Uttar Pradesh, praising the state’s contribution to Indian culture and heritage. He said that under the double-engine government, Uttar Pradesh has transformed over the last nine years from a BIMARU state to a remarkable development model. He expressed strong belief that Uttar Pradesh will play a key role in driving India’s future growth.

Amit Shah Highlights Cultural Strength and Infrastructure Growth

Union Home Minister Amit Shah also wished the people of Uttar Pradesh. He described the state as a land enriched by Sanatan culture and blessed by the Ganga and Yamuna. He said that Uttar Pradesh has always guided the nation through culture, strength, and resolve, and is now setting new benchmarks in development and world-class infrastructure.

CM Yogi Adityanath Calls UP India’s Growth Engine

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ath extended special greetings to Non-Resident Uttar Pradesh citizens across the world. He said that their hard work and values have enhanced the image of both Uttar Pradesh and India globally. He added that the state has broken free from past struggles and policy neglect, emerging as India’s growth engine with immense future potential.

Defence Minister Rajnath Singh’s Wishes

Defence Minister Rajnath Singh said that Uttar Pradesh represents a powerful symbol of India’s nature and culture. He noted that the state has been writing new chapters of good governance and development for the past nine years and wished continued progress for the people of Uttar Pradesh.
